SANTA BARBARA, Calif. (KEYT) The 11th Annual Organ Donation Walk & BBQ raised awareness in Santa Barbara.

One Legacy teamed up with future donors, recipients and supporters to make the event special.

It started the walk at Leadbetter Beach.

Participants walked to Stearns Wharf and back.

Some donor recipients and relatives of donors helped at the information tent.

The cofounders of the event shared some of their story before the walk.

Scott Burns recalled needing a rescue while on a friends boat in the Channel Islands.

He ended up with a kidney donated by Jennifer Guerra's sister Vivian.

"Vivian died suddenly, basically Memorial Day 2015, I ended up getting her kidney," said Burns.

"If anybody would have ended up with my sister's kidney I am so glad it was you," said Guerra.  

He is now like a family member.

Westmont College nursing students helped out with the event.

Some of the students said they had the pink donor dot on their license.

Donors can request it online or at the DMV.

Donor recipients said it is a good idea to let your family and friends know your wishes.
